Transaction 82cdcff289b7b707e5a8471169c67ac044a221379c27e255ad42de49c0e71189
1 Input
1 Output
-
82cdcff289b7b707e5a8471169c67ac044a221379c27e255ad42de49c0e71189:0
- value
- 14160926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a93170668f8e4d74eddcba26018f19b73488bf4 OP_EQUAL
- address
- MBnGpUXQkqgmTBh6KjQiWkzf4aaDRRqS3S